The Cambodian prince Norodom Ravichak took the floor to affirm his intention to buy back the club, on sale since April 13, 2021. “It is correct that I officially applied for the resumption of AS Saint-Etienne”, a he declared this Tuesday to RFI, thus confirming our information.

“I am passionate about football and I grew up being enthusiastic about the French league and of course for the France team,” said Norodom Ravichak, who is not the crown prince and wanted to make it clear. This is how I have always had a special affection for ASSE, which occupies a special place among the very big clubs in France. Thanks to my various business networks, I was able to meet personalities from the world of football and gradually learn about the ASSE sales plan a few months ago. My goal today is to take care of Saint-Etienne and all those who work to restore this club to its rightful place in French and European football. “

Norodom Ravichak expresses his wish to invest in the long term in this project, accompanied by “solid partners” that he will present “when the time comes”. “If we come to an agreement, I will provide sufficient resources to achieve these ambitions and allow Saint-Etienne to regain its splendor,” he adds.

He has deposited a deposit of 100 million with the consultancy firm KPMG, the body screening applications for the takeover of the French football club.
